Abstract
Background: Training teachers through educational programs are necessmy for fulfilling health science teaching competencies. Short-term workshop has variously reported as an influential training program.Purpose: The purpose was to determine the effects of educational workshops on teaching pe1jormance of medical teachers.Methods: A 29-item questionnaire containing demographic information, and attitude, changes of interest, educational pe!formance and ability, and also participants' comments and suggestions were administered after the three educational workshops.Results: Results highlight effects 011 changing the behavior mostly in increasing the teaching performance. They also indicate more improvement of younger faculty who had recently started their educational activities.Conclusion: Further evaluations are needed to determine all the aspects of teaching performance for having most effectual educational workshops.
